NOTICE
The IRS will provide TLD a minimum of 48 hours
advance notice that an assessment needs to be administered. TLD
will be contacted for the assessment service by a senior management
official within one of the operating units. TLD will then communicate
the relevant information to The Language Specialist.

Using a 4-part assessment, TLD’s Language Specialist will
perform an assessment of a given applicant’s fluency in a
given language. The assessment will be administered by telephone
and by facsimile.
Each assessment will not exceed one (1) hour. The assessment consists
of four (4) parts:
- The ability to converse in a given language. (The TLD Language
Specialist will converse with the applicant and exchange written
materials for purposes of assessing his/her oral and written fluency.)
- The ability to write in a given language. (The TLD Language
Specialist will fax the applicant a letter to be translated into
English.)
- The ability to translate from the foreign language into English.
(The TLD Language Specialist will provide the applicant a letter
in the respective foreign language to be translated into English.)
- The ability to translate from English into the foreign language.
(The TLD Language Specialist will provide the applicant a letter
in English to be translated into the respective foreign language.)
When the applicant has finished the two written exercises, the exercises
are faxed back to the TLD Language Specialist to be evaluated.
The Language Specialist will assess the applicant using a Language
Skills Assessment Form (LSAF). Each candidate will be rated
on a pass/fail basis for each of the 4 parts of the assessment.
Each candidate will receive an overall pass/fail rating as well.
The Language Specialist will provide the LSAF, including recommendations
and comments regarding employment to the IRS Project Manager within
24 hour of the assessment via facsimile and/or e-mail.

Cancellation Policy
• More than 48 hour notification prior to assessment: 25%
charge
• Between 48-24 hour notification: 50% charge
• Less than 24 hour notification: 75% charge
